Essential Considerations for Selecting Appropriate Skateboarding Footwear

This section outlines key factors to consider when choosing skateboarding footwear, particularly focusing on designs and features often associated with the aforementioned endorsed models. Prioritizing these elements can significantly impact performance, safety, and the longevity of the footwear.

Tip 1: Prioritize Durability. Evaluate the materials used in the shoe’s construction. Suede and leather are generally more resistant to abrasion than canvas. Reinforced stitching in high-wear areas, such as the ollie patch and toe cap, is essential for preventing premature deterioration.

Tip 2: Examine Sole Construction. The sole’s design directly affects board feel and impact absorption. Vulcanized soles offer excellent board feel but may lack substantial cushioning. Cupsole constructions typically provide greater impact protection at the expense of board feel. Consider the skateboarding style and the types of terrain encountered.

Tip 3: Assess Cushioning and Impact Protection. Skateboarding subjects the feet to significant impact forces. Insoles featuring gel or foam cushioning can mitigate these forces, reducing the risk of heel bruising and other foot injuries. Some footwear incorporates proprietary cushioning technologies specifically designed for skateboarding.

Tip 4: Verify Proper Fit. Ill-fitting footwear can lead to blisters, discomfort, and reduced board control. Ensure that the shoe fits snugly without being too tight, allowing for adequate toe movement. Try the shoes on while wearing skateboarding socks to ensure an accurate fit.

Tip 5: Consider Breathability. Skateboarding is a physically demanding activity that can cause the feet to sweat. Shoes with breathable linings or ventilation holes can help to keep the feet cool and dry, reducing the risk of fungal infections and discomfort.

Tip 6: Evaluate Lacing System. The lacing system should provide a secure and customizable fit. Recessed or reinforced eyelets can prevent lace breakage. Some models feature lace protection systems that shield the laces from abrasion during skateboarding.

Tip 7: Analyze Board Feel. The thickness and flexibility of the sole influence board feel, which is the ability to sense the board beneath the feet. A thinner, more flexible sole provides greater board feel, while a thicker, more rigid sole offers greater protection. Determine the appropriate balance based on personal preference and skateboarding style.

1. Impact Absorption

1. Impact Absorption, Skate Shoes

Impact absorption is a critical performance characteristic in skateboarding footwear, particularly within models endorsed by professional skaters. The repeated stresses placed on the feet during skateboarding, including landing jumps and performing tricks, necessitate effective impact mitigation. Insufficient impact absorption can lead to injuries, such as heel bruising, stress fractures, and ankle sprains. Footwear lines, such as those associated with Chris Cole, often incorporate advanced insole technologies, such as gel inserts or proprietary foam compounds, specifically designed to attenuate these forces. These features directly contribute to a reduction in impact-related injuries, thereby enhancing the skater’s ability to perform and train consistently.

The design and material selection play a significant role in determining the level of impact absorption. Denser foams and strategically placed cushioning elements within the midsole and insole are common features. For instance, a shoe marketed with enhanced heel support might employ a thicker layer of cushioning material in that specific area. The construction of the outsole also contributes; some designs incorporate air pockets or other shock-absorbing structures within the rubber. Ultimately, the interaction between the insole, midsole, and outsole determines the overall effectiveness of the impact absorption system.

2. Sole Durability

2. Sole Durability, Skate Shoes

Sole durability represents a critical performance attribute in skateboarding footwear, particularly in models associated with professional skateboarders such as Chris Cole. Skateboarding inherently subjects footwear soles to intense abrasion and impact, predominantly from contact with the skateboard deck and the ground during landings and tricks. Inadequate sole durability directly translates to diminished shoe lifespan, increased expenditure on replacements, and potentially compromised performance due to reduced grip and board feel. Footwear lines linked to Chris Cole often prioritize robust sole constructions utilizing high-abrasion rubber compounds and reinforced patterns designed to withstand the specific stresses imposed by skateboarding.

The selection of appropriate materials and construction techniques directly impacts sole longevity. High-density rubber, often incorporating carbon reinforcement, resists wear more effectively than softer, less resilient compounds. Vulcanized construction, where the sole is bonded to the upper via heat and pressure, generally provides superior durability compared to cemented construction. Specific tread patterns, such as those designed with deep grooves or multi-directional lugs, enhance grip and distribute wear across a larger surface area. The DC Shoes Cole Pro model, for instance, historically featured a durable cupsole construction with a multi-directional tread pattern designed for enhanced grip and longevity, reflecting the performance demands of professional skateboarding.

4. Board Feel

4. Board Feel, Skate Shoes

Board feel, a skater’s tactile perception of the skateboard beneath their feet, represents a critical performance factor in skateboarding footwear. This sensitivity allows for precise control, nuanced adjustments, and an intuitive connection between the skater and the board. Footwear endorsed by professionals, including those associated with Chris Cole, often emphasizes design elements intended to optimize board feel, acknowledging its impact on trick execution and overall skateboarding performance.

  • Sole Thickness and Flexibility

    The thickness and flexibility of the sole significantly influence board feel. Thinner soles provide greater sensitivity, allowing the skater to feel subtle contours and changes in the terrain. More flexible soles conform to the shape of the board, enhancing grip and control during complex maneuvers. The compromise lies in reduced impact protection; therefore, designs that optimize board feel must balance sensitivity with sufficient cushioning to mitigate landing forces. Some “chris cole skate shoes” models utilize thinner, more flexible sole constructions in the forefoot area to maximize board feel while maintaining heel protection.

  • Material Composition of the Sole

    The specific rubber compounds used in the sole’s construction also affect board feel. Softer, more pliable rubbers offer increased grip and conformability, enhancing the skater’s sense of connection with the board. Conversely, harder, more durable rubbers may reduce sensitivity but extend the shoe’s lifespan. The ideal material blend balances grip, durability, and board feel. Formulations engineered for enhanced grip can translate to increased confidence in board control, particularly in technical skateboarding maneuvers. Shoes bearing Chris Cole’s endorsement often feature proprietary rubber compounds tailored to his performance requirements.

  • Internal Construction and Lasting Techniques

    The internal construction of the shoe and the lasting techniques employed during manufacturing contribute indirectly to board feel. A streamlined internal design minimizes unnecessary bulk and ensures a snug, responsive fit. Careful lasting techniques ensure that the sole conforms closely to the shape of the foot, enhancing the skater’s sense of connection with the board. Internal padding and support structures should be strategically placed to provide cushioning without compromising sensitivity. Shoes bearing Chris Cole’s signature often feature a minimalist internal design focused on maximizing board feel and control.

  • Outsole Tread Pattern and Design

    The tread pattern of the outsole influences the skater’s ability to grip the board and maintain control. A flatter, smoother tread pattern generally provides greater board feel than a heavily lugged or textured pattern. However, some texture is necessary to prevent slippage. The ideal tread pattern balances grip and sensitivity, allowing the skater to feel the board without sacrificing control. “Chris cole skate shoes” designs may incorporate unique tread patterns optimized for his specific skateboarding style and preferences, demonstrating the connection between board feel and performance.

5. Material Quality

5. Material Quality, Skate Shoes

Material quality is a cornerstone of skateboarding footwear, directly influencing durability, performance, and overall skater satisfaction. In models associated with professional skateboarders, such as those endorsed by Chris Cole, meticulous material selection becomes even more critical, reflecting the heightened demands of high-impact skateboarding and prolonged use. The quality of materials employed impacts resistance to abrasion, structural integrity, and comfort, each contributing to the shoe’s ability to withstand the rigors of skateboarding and provide optimal performance.

  • Suede and Leather Selection

    The quality of suede and leather utilized in the upper construction significantly impacts the shoe’s resistance to abrasion and its ability to maintain shape over time. High-grade suede, characterized by a tight nap and uniform thickness, offers superior abrasion resistance compared to lower-quality alternatives. Full-grain leather, known for its durability and natural water resistance, provides enhanced protection and support. In “chris cole skate shoes,” the selection of premium suede or leather translates to a longer lifespan, reduced wear and tear from repeated contact with the skateboard deck, and sustained structural integrity, enhancing both performance and longevity.

  • Rubber Compound Composition

    The composition of the rubber compound used in the outsole directly affects grip, durability, and board feel. High-quality rubber compounds, often formulated with specialized additives, offer enhanced abrasion resistance and superior traction on a variety of surfaces. Inferior rubber compounds may exhibit premature wear, reduced grip, and compromised board feel, negatively impacting performance and increasing the risk of slippage. The implementation of high-grade rubber compounds in the soles of “chris cole skate shoes” ensures optimal grip, extended lifespan, and a consistent skating experience, contributing to confident board control and improved performance.

  • Textile Linings and Stitching

    The quality of textile linings and stitching contributes to both comfort and structural integrity. Durable, breathable textile linings enhance comfort by wicking away moisture and preventing chafing. Reinforced stitching, particularly in high-stress areas, reinforces the shoe’s construction and prevents premature failure. “Chris cole skate shoes” designs that incorporate high-quality textile linings and reinforced stitching provide a comfortable and durable fit, minimizing discomfort and maximizing the shoe’s ability to withstand the stresses of skateboarding.

  • Cushioning Materials and Insoles

    The quality of cushioning materials and insoles directly impacts impact absorption and overall comfort. High-density foam or gel-based insoles effectively attenuate impact forces, reducing the risk of heel bruising and other foot injuries. Inferior cushioning materials may compress quickly and provide inadequate support, leading to discomfort and potential injuries. The incorporation of high-quality cushioning materials and insoles in “chris cole skate shoes” ensures optimal impact absorption, providing a comfortable and protective platform for skateboarding, allowing skaters to perform at their best and minimize the risk of impact-related injuries.
